A mother was called out for picking favorites between her two daughters.
She shared what happened on Reddit’s “Am I the A******? (AITA)” forum. Her eldest daughter Haley has struggled with infertility, while her youngest Stephanie is currently pregnant. While throwing a baby shower, Haley called the mom out on favoring Stephanie’s needs.
“I (56F) have two daughters ‘Haley’ (32F) and ‘Stephanie’ (29F),” she wrote. “Stephanie is 5 months pregnant with her first child. The father is not in the picture. Haley and her husband have been struggling with infertility for a few years. She has always been jealous of Stephanie but the pregnancy is making her even more jealous.Recently I threw a baby shower for Stephanie. Haley lives a 16 hour drive away and Stephanie lives 4 hours away. I have only one guest bedroom with a queen bed. I also have a futon in the basement.”
“Haley and her husband arrived first and I told them to sleep on the futon in the basement because the guest bedroom was reserved for Stephanie. I made up the futon with extra padding and thick blankets to make it as comfy as possible for them. Haley threw a fit because they drove 16 hours and I told her that Stephanie needed a comfortable bed because she’s pregnant. Haley didn’t listen and she and her husband went into the guest bedroom to take a nap.”
“They woke up and made up the bed then moved to the basement before Stephanie arrived but when Stephanie wasn’t happy when she found out that her bed had already been slept in,” she explained. “They got into a small argument over that, and Haley accused me of playing favorites. I explained that she has never been pregnant so she doesn’t understand how taxing pregnancy can be on the body.”
“The next morning as we were getting ready for the baby shower Stephanie saw on Instagram that the baby’s father had found himself a new girlfriend. I spent an hour consoling her while Haley and her husband set up everything. I came downstairs and Haley started complaining about what a ‘drama queen’ Stephanie is and I’m ‘enabling’ her. I told her that if she was going to keep up her negative attitude, she’d better leave because I wasn’t going to let her ruin the baby shower. They left in a huff. When some of the guests asked why Haley wasn’t there I told them the truth, and a few thought I was being too harsh. AITA?”
Redditors thought the mom was the problem here.
“At least you were honest enough that everyone else was able to see your blatant favoritism toward Stephanie,” a user wrote.
“Wow you seem to have no sympathy for you oldest daughter at all,” another commented.
“Your behaviour is driving a wedge between your daughters who are already dealing with some pretty intense rivalry without your help,” someone added.
